                  MATH 21003 - Introduction to Statistics and Probability Credit Hours: 3
  ACTS: MATH 2103
  This course is an algebra-based course involving the presentation and interpretation of data, probability, sampling, basic inference, correlation, and regression, and analysis of variance. It may include the use of statistical software. A TI-84 graphing calculator is required for this course and the course requires an online learning component.
  
ACTS: MATH 2103 
Course Code History: MATH 2320
  Prerequisite(s):  Must meet one of the following requirements 
	- MATH 11103  or MATH 11003  with a grade of “C” or better
 
	- A score of 26 or higher on the mathematics section of the ACT
 
	- A score of 86 or above on the Accuplacer College Math Placement Test
 
	- A score of 263 or higher on the Accuplacer Next Gen Advanced Algebra Placement Test
 
	- Permission of the department chair or school dean
 
  Course Typically Offered:  F, S, Su
